Output 751986f5f83b71f9bc66ad6bef96b8b5e8f66583df19107eebd3140ec5ded6fa:0

value
17000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 37e1b6296a37383d139eb091ce6a9c356b3609c1 OP_EQUALVERIFY OP_CHECKSIG
address
166UZGPzKkexw5oWvveDv48VoqMmk72jEB
transaction
751986f5f83b71f9bc66ad6bef96b8b5e8f66583df19107eebd3140ec5ded6fa
spent
true